Dominie Traditional Tales Books in Order
3 books by Allen Trussell-Cullen. Reading level: Grades 1.7–2.7. Lower Grades (Ages 5–8).
Series books grow with readers — but that's also the trap. Most series start at one reading level and one content intensity and drift upward over the course of the run. Dominie Traditional Tales (3 books by Allen Trussell-Cullen) lands at reading level Grades 1.7–2.7, with average content intensity 1/5. Intensity stays consistent across the series — a kid who can handle the first book can generally handle the rest.
